Evaluation of bone mineral density in premenopausal women with type-2 diabetes mellitus in Zahedan, southeast Iran.

Zahra Zakeri1, Zohreh Azizi, Hamid Mehrabifar, Mohammad Hashemi.   

Abstract

OBJECTIVE: To determine the BMD in premenopausal women with type-2 diabetes mellitus.
METHODS: This case-control study was performed on 60 premenopausal women with type-2 diabetes mellitus and 60 normal premenopausal subjects. The groups were not completely matched regarding BMI; but they were in the range of obesity. Bone mineral density was determined using dual energy X-ray absorptiometry (DXA) to define bone mineral density (BMD) in second to fourth lumbar vertebrae and the neck of the femur (g/cm2).
RESULTS: The results showed that BMD, T- and Z-score of femoral neck, total femur, L2, and Ward's were not significantly different between type 2 diabetic and normal premenopausal women (p > 0.5). A significant increase of L3 BMD and L2-L4 Z-score was observed in diabetic group (p < 0.05). In addition BMD, T- and Z-score of L4 were significantly higher in type 2 diabetic women than normal premenopausal women (P < 0.05).
CONCLUSION: Higher BMD was noted over the spine in diabetic group which may be due to higher BMI in this group.
